Job Summary
The Structured Cabling Technician I is an entry-level role responsible for assisting in the installation and maintenance of low-voltage cabling systems in commercial environments. This position involves installing, routing, dressing, and terminating CAT5/E and CAT6 cables while following blueprints, safety guidelines, and company procedures. The Technician I works under supervision to support structured cabling projects, gaining hands-on experience and developing the skills necessary for career progression within the telecom and low-voltage industry.

Job Responsibilities
  • Install and route cable infrastructure including CAT5/E and CAT6 cabling systems
  • Dress and route cables into IT closets, modular furniture, and designated outlet locations
  • Install cable pathways such as J-hooks, D-rings, cable trays, and ladder racks
  • Perform cable management, including dressing, bundling, and labeling
  • Terminate cables at jacks, keystones, and modular plugs (RJ-45)
  • Assist with Wireless Access Point (WAP) installation
  • Read, interpret, and follow blueprints and written instructions for installations
  • Communicate clearly and professionally with team members and supervisors
  • Maintain compliance with all safety protocols, including proper use of PPE and jobsite cleanup per OSHA standards
Job Requirements
  • High school diploma or GED required
  • 0-2 years of experience in commercial structured cabling, low-voltage, or data cable installation
  • OSHA 10 certification preferred
  • Basic understanding of cabling tools, equipment, and installation procedures
  • Ability to read and follow blueprints and technical instructions
  • Strong attention to detail, reliability, and commitment to learning industry standards
Physical Requirements
  • Ability to work on ladders, scissor lifts, and in confined spaces
  • Ability to lift up to 50 pounds and move up to 75 pounds
  • Ability to stand, walk, and perform physical labor for extended periods
Tools Required
  • Basic hand tools: screwdriver (multi-bit), tape measure, snips, needle-nose pliers, channel locks, cable stripper, punch down tool, flashlight, gloves, and tool pouch
  • Work boots (steel toe or composite toe) required
